Understanding Manual Workflow Handoffs
Manual workflow handoffs are points in a business process where tasks or data are transferred between individuals, teams, or systems without automated triggers. In professional services, these handoffs commonly occur during client onboarding, project initiation, resource allocation, timesheet submission, and invoice generation. Each handoff introduces the potential for delays, errors, and miscommunication, impacting overall operational efficiency.
For instance, when a new client is onboarded, data may need to be manually entered into multiple systems, including CRM, project management, and accounting. This not only consumes valuable time but also increases the risk of data entry errors. Similarly, when a project phase is completed, manual handoffs may be required to initiate the next phase, allocate resources, or generate invoices, leading to delays and reduced productivity.
The Role of Odoo ERP in Automation
Odoo ERP provides a comprehensive suite of applications that can be integrated to automate manual workflow handoffs in professional services. Key modules include Project, CRM, Accounting, Invoicing, and Timesheets, which can be configured to work together seamlessly. By leveraging Odoo's automation capabilities, firms can eliminate manual data entry, streamline approvals, and ensure real-time data synchronization across systems.
For example, Odoo's Project module can be integrated with the CRM to automatically create projects when a sales opportunity is won. This eliminates the need for manual project initiation and ensures that project details are accurately transferred from the CRM. Similarly, the Timesheets module can be linked to the Accounting module to automate invoice generation based on recorded times, reducing manual billing efforts and improving accuracy.

Workflow Architecture and Data Flow
Effective automation requires a well-defined workflow architecture that outlines how data flows between systems and how tasks are triggered. In Odoo, this can be achieved by configuring automated actions, scheduled actions, and server-side workflows. For example, when a project phase is completed, an automated action can trigger the creation of a new task for the next phase, notify relevant stakeholders, and update the project status.
Data flow is critical to ensuring that information is accurately and consistently transferred between systems. Odoo's integration capabilities allow for real-time data synchronization between modules, reducing the risk of data inconsistencies. For instance, when a timesheet is submitted, the data is automatically updated in the Accounting module, ensuring that invoices are generated based on the most current information.
Integration and API Considerations
Odoo's API capabilities, including REST API, JSON-RPC, and XML-RPC, enable seamless integration with external systems and applications. This is particularly important for professional services firms that use multiple tools and platforms, such as CRM, project management, and billing systems. By leveraging Odoo's APIs, firms can automate data exchange between systems, reducing manual data entry and improving data accuracy.
For example, Odoo can be integrated with a client portal to automatically update project status and share deliverables with clients. This eliminates the need for manual communication and ensures that clients have real-time visibility into project progress. Similarly, Odoo can be integrated with payment systems to automate invoice payment processing, reducing manual billing efforts and improving cash flow.

Risks and Trade-offs
While automation offers significant benefits, it also introduces risks and trade-offs that must be considered. For example, over-automation can lead to reduced flexibility and increased complexity, making it difficult to adapt to changing business needs. Additionally, automation requires ongoing maintenance and monitoring to ensure that workflows continue to function as intended.
To mitigate these risks, firms should adopt a phased approach to automation, starting with high-impact, low-complexity processes and gradually expanding to more complex workflows. Regular monitoring and optimization should be conducted to ensure that automation continues to deliver value and that any issues are addressed promptly.
